Timken acquires Lovejoy including its subsidiary R+L Hydraulics

19 August, 2016

The Timken Company, manufacturer of tapered roller bearings, has acquired Lovejoy, Inc. and its subsidiary, R+L Hydraulics GmbH. Lovejoy, a manufacturer of industrial couplings, universal joints and hydraulics, was purchased for approximately 66 million USD.


“The acquisition of Lovejoy is a great strategic fit, and we are pleased to add their strong brand to our growing portfolio of industrial brands,” said Richard G. Kyle, Timken’s president and chief executive officer. “Lovejoy and R+L Hydraulics feature premium products used in challenging applications across diverse markets. While our two companies operate in many of the same markets and channels in North America, the acquisition provides exciting growth opportunities.”

Headquartered in Downers Grove, Illinois, USA, with additional locations in the USA, Canada and Germany, Lovejoy is widely recognized for its flexible coupling design and as the creator of the jaw-style coupling. Lovejoy also manufactures a line of universal joints, vibration dampening products and hydraulics. For the 12 months ending 31 March 2016, Lovejoy sales were approximately 56 million USD.

Lovejoy’s hydraulics business, R+L Hydraulics, is based in Werdohl, Germany, and manufactures and distributes products for the fluid power and power transmission industries. R + L Hydraulics sells a wide range of hydraulic components, heat exchangers and couplings. The products are mainly used in the fields of stationary and mobile hydraulics, mechanical engineering, wind power, construction machinery, and in the steel and offshore industries.

Further market penetration

“Following the acquisition of our parent company Lovejoy by Timken, we are convinced that we will strengthen our activities in the field of power transmission products and will penetrate further market areas," says Dr. Peter Jaschke, managing director of R + L Hydraulics. The former managing director of R + L Hydraulics, Lothar Gaedtke, will retire at the end of 2016. Mathew W. Happach has already taken over his position as additional managing director of R+L Hydraulics.

This acquisition adds to Timken’s growing portfolio of mechanical power transmission products. In recent years, Timken has been diversifying its offering, completing a number of acquisitions featuring products adjacent to its core bearing lines. This includes belts, chain, gear drive systems, lubrication systems and a variety of related services, all marketed under brands including Timken, Philadelphia Gear, Carlisle, Drives and Interlube. Timken expects the acquisition to be accretive to earnings in the first year of ownership, excluding one-time transaction costs.
